Cresciuto nelle giovanili di Eurobasket, fa il suo esordio in Serie A con la maglia della Virtus Roma il 16 marzo 20114 nella sfida persa dai suoi contro l’Olimpia Milano. Nella stagione 2015-2016 va a giocare in A2; prima Mantova, poi Tortona e Imola, formazione dove sfodera un’ottima stagione da 12.3 punti e 5.7 rimbalzi di media a partita. Tra il 2018 ed il 2020 è a Treviso: il primo anno conquista la promozione in Serie A giocando da protagonista; il secondo aiuta i suoi a mantenere la massima serie con ottime percentuali, soprattutto da 3 (44.2%). Nonostante questo, nel 2020-2021 si trasferisce a Trieste. Agli ordini di coach Dalmasson (assistito dal “nostro” Marco Legovich), Davide si rende protagonista di una stagione da favola che gli vale la chiamata da Milano nel 2021-2022. In maglia Olimpia rimane due anni vincendo due Scudetti ed una Coppa Italia e facendo il suo esordio in Eurolega. Terminata l’esperienza milanese, lo scorso anno, veste la maglia di Trento, chiudendo la stagione a 10.4 punti (40% da 3) e 3.3 rimbalzi di media a gara.
Alviti ha vestito anche la canotta di Italbasket in 8 occasioni, partecipando alle partite di qualificazione agli Europei del 2022.